RE: how manny g.p.i. for hunting?
I use a beaman 340 arrow. my total arrow weight is 414 grains.
I used to use spitefires but I found out I got the same preformance from a shockwave, which saves some money. I find when I paper tune my bow and get a bullet hole as they say. I can take an ultimate steel broadhead and stack it right with a field tip arrow. Have you paper tuned you bow?? |
